Order 1 strongly minimal sets in differentially closed fields
arXiv:math/0510233
Abstract
We give a classification of non-orthogonality classes of trivial order 1 strongly minimal sets in differentially closed fields. A central idea is the introduction of -forms, functions on the prolongation of a variety which are analogous to 1-forms. Order 1 strongly minimal sets then correspond to smooth projective curves with -forms. We also introduce -differentials, algebraic versions of -forms which are analogous to usual differentials, and develop their basic properties. This enables us to reformulate our classification scheme-theoretically in terms of curves with -invertible sheaves. This work partially generalizes and extends results of Hrushovski and Itai.
